动态网站设计的核心在于数据库后端技术的整合。通过合理的设计与实现,可以提升网站的功能性和用户体验。数据库作为数据存储和管理的关键部分,直接影响到网站的性能和稳定性。
在实际开发中,常见的数据库后端技术包括MySQL、PostgreSQL、MongoDB等。选择合适的数据库类型取决于项目需求,例如关系型数据库适合需要事务处理的应用,而NoSQL数据库则更适合处理非结构化数据。

AI绘图结果,仅供参考
数据库与前端页面的交互通常通过后端语言如PHP、Python或Node.js实现。这些语言能够接收用户请求,查询数据库,并将结果返回给前端展示。这种交互过程需要确保数据的安全性与完整性。
整合过程中,使用API接口是一种常见且高效的方式。RESTful API能够提供标准化的数据交换方式,使前后端分离更加清晰,便于维护和扩展。同时,采用JSON或XML格式传输数据,提高了系统的兼容性。
为了保证数据库的安全性,开发者应注重输入验证、防止SQL注入等攻击。•定期备份数据、设置访问权限也是保障系统稳定运行的重要措施。
实战中,建议从简单的CRUD操作开始,逐步构建复杂功能。通过不断测试和优化,可以提高系统的响应速度和可靠性。最终目标是实现一个高效、安全且易于维护的动态网站。